2022:

2nd rd picks GEORGE PICKENS (1941 yards in 2 seasons including 1140 last year); plus Christian Watson (an emerging star if he can stay healthy) and Alec Pierce,  plus Romeo Dobbs in the 4th and Shakir in the 5th

 

2021: the 2nd rd was not great but

Elijah Moore is a solid player from the 2nd, Josh Palmer is good from the 3rd, Nico Collins from the 3rd is an emerging star and Amon St Brown from the 4th is a huge star already.

 

2020:

Did you forget Michael Pittman in the 2nd rd? Davis and Mooney were good later round picks.

 

2019:

Deebo Samuel, AJ Brown & DK Metcalf were all 2nd rd picks. Diontae Johnson and Terry McLaurin went in the 3rd


George Pickens had the most flukish 1,000 yard season I’ve ever seen. Had only 5 100 yard games including one at 195 but also had 7 games under 50 yards. It was very boom or bust with him

5 hours ago, gonzo1105 said:


Your right and you also contradicted yourself by using Diggs as an example when he plays with Josh Allen unless your insinuating that Pickens is a better WR than Diggs than I get  what your saying 

I'd say right now he is.  

 

Diggs had 1183 on 107 catches (160 targets) or 11.1 yds/c.  Pickens had 1140 on only 63 catches (106 targets) or 18.1 yds/c.  Diggs had only 19 20+ yard plays, while Pickens had 42.  Pickens did all this on a team with terrible QB play.  What would his stats be with a good QB targeting him 160 times a season? 1700 yards? More?

If you listen to Brandon Beanes last interview about what he looks for in the WR position, he states versatility and I believe he said that at least 3 times while talking about this WR class. I take everything with a grain of salt around this time of year but to me that screams Xavier Legette, who played inside, outside and as a returner for South Carolina. We may even be able to trade down a few slots and pick up an extra draft pick if we had a few WR rated equally. He ran a 4.39 40 time and if you look at separation, this guy just gets it imo, Steve Smith Sr. called him a better D.K. Metcalf coming out of college which I don't usually listen to many opinions on players as I use my own eyeballs but I definitely listen to him since he speaks his mind and not just the typical media fluff pieces. I usually don't lock on to 1 player on draft day for disappointment reasons but I'm really liking this prospect more and more.
